Bitumen 100/150 – Properties, Applications, and Benefits
Bitumen 100/150 is a versatile penetration grade bitumen produced through the vacuum aeration process in refineries. The designation "100/150" indicates its penetration value, a measure of its softness, falling between 100 and 150 tenths of a millimeter under standard test conditions. This medium-soft consistency makes it particularly well-suited for mild climates.

| Feature | Bitumen 40/50 | Bitumen 60/70 | Bitumen 100/150 | Bitumen 180/200 |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Penetration (dmm) | 40–50 | 60–70 | 100–150 | 180–200 |
| Hardness | Harder | Medium-Hard | Medium-Soft | Softer |
| Viscosity | Higher | Medium-High | Moderate | Lower |
| Temperature Use | Hotter | Moderate | Mild | Colder |
| Flexibility | Lower | Medium | Higher | Highest |

| Test title | Explanations | Standard Range | Test Method | |
| min | max | |||
| Penetration | at 25°C,(100 g,5 sec),mm/10 | 100 | 150 | EN 1426 |
| Softening Point | °C | 39 | 47 | EN 1427 |
| Flash Point | (Cleveland Open Cup),°C | 230 | ** | EN ISO 2592 |
| Solubility | in trichloroethylene , % | 99 | ** | EN 12592 |
| Kinematic Viscosity | at 135°c , mm2/s | 175 | ** | EN 12595 |
| Resistance to Hardening at 163°C | ||||
| Retained Penetration | % | 43 | ** | EN 12607-1 |
| Increase in Softening Point | °C | ** | 10 | |
| Change of Mass | % | ** | 0.8 | |
